LONGi, a global leader in solar technology, has secured a significant agreement with ENGIE, a renowned energy group, to deploy its cutting-edge Hi-MO 9 modules in major utility-scale solar projects across the Middle East and North Africa (MENA) region. This collaboration marks a pivotal moment in the evolution of large-scale solar energy and highlights the growing recognition of back contact (BC) technology as a revolutionary solution for high-performance renewable energy installations. This partnership between LONGi and ENGIE emphasizes the transformative potential of the Hi-MO 9 modules, powered by innovative BC technology. With a maximum power output of 670W, a major efficiency rate of 24.8%, and bifaciality up to 80%, Hi-MO 9 represents a significant advancement in photovoltaic technology. The design, which relocates all cell electrodes to the rear of the module, eliminates shading losses and maximizes light capture, resulting in industry-leading conversion efficiency. Additionally, the Hi-MO 9’s enhanced temperature coefficient performance ensures stable power output, even in harsh environmental conditions. Combined with LONGi’s rigorous quality standards, these modules provide developers with unmatched reliability and long-term returns.
